In my opinion I feel like /e/OS is too bloated and I don't like the iOS inspired theme. If you prefer stock android you should choose LineageOS. BTW there is also a fork of LineageOS called LineageOS for microG, should you need Play Services.
hydrogen
As far as I know you can't, but what I did was to connect the drive to a PC (Windows or Linux) and make a SMB share of it. There is an app on F-Droid that can connect to SMB shares.
Take out the hard drive out of your laptop and put the drive for the server in it, install Debian using the built in monitor and keyboard of your laptop.
I use this all the time, also nice for text share.
And recently Llama3 and Mixtral!
I've a Dreame L10s Ultra flashed with it, very happy with my purchase. A bit scary to install everything but if you read the instructions before doing it you should be fine :)
I use SplittyPie allot with my friends if we go on a trip/do something together. Works really well. You can install it as a PWA and it's FOSS ;)
RSS Guard seems to have support for Google Reader API, so FreshRSS is also supported. It's also a Qt application. You can also find other clients on the 3rd party clients page of FreshRSS
You have to flash an extra file if you need the proprietary Google Play Services, at default LineageOS is just stock android without it. MicroG is is indeed an open source reimplementation of GPS, so it spoofs your device as it has the real GPS installed.
Also it uses other (local) database of network locations (UnifiedNlp) so when using a maps app it will find your location faster and more accurate than only relying on gps (the positioning system, not Google Play Service) ;)